
EXCLUSIVE: British The Voice star Jamie Miller has spoken about her close relationship with her coach, Jennifer Hudson, with whom she is still in contact, six years after the show.
Jamie Miller wowed the nation with her amazing voice when she appeared on The Voice UK in 2017 after performing James Bay’s song Let It Go.
During his time on the show, Jamie, 24, wowed the judges every week as he continued to progress on the ITV talent show.
After impressing the judges and fans, Jamie made it to the grand finale where he performed Justin Bieber’s hit What Do You Mean.
Now, six years into his period, Jamie has exclusively revealed that he has been in frequent contact with his coach Jennifer Hudson, who continues to be a source of inspiration for him.

He said: “Even today we keep in touch, he is one of the sweetest people I have ever met.
“She was really instrumental in mentoring and I texted her just a few weeks ago – she’s so lovely and working with her and her talent is amazing, but knowing her as a person is completely different.
“You see through the heart, you hear the stories, she really cares about me, it’s great to know her and protect me.”

The Welsh star added: “My manager and I were in New York just a few months ago and we were walking down the street and we met her.
“It’s crazy how life works and I just pinch myself.”
Jamie continued: “Behind the scenes I only saw her as Jennifer, she made me feel good and I felt like I deserved to be there and she gave me advice that I am considering now.

“I’m very grateful and I think The Voice was just a stepping stone in the career I want to follow.
